Storage & Reheating
Allow the brownies to cool completely before storing. Keep them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. For longer storage, wrap them tightly and freeze for up to three months. To enjoy them warm, reheat in the microwave for about 10-15 seconds or until just warmed through.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use a different flavor of cake mix?
Absolutely! You can swap the chocolate cake mix for any flavor you like, such as vanilla or red velvet, for a unique twist. Just keep in mind that the flavor profile will change, and you may want to adjust the add-ins accordingly.
How can I make these brownies gluten-free?
To make gluten-free brownies, use a gluten-free chocolate cake mix instead of regular cake mix. Ensure that all other ingredients, like the eggs and sugar, are gluten-free as well. This will allow you to enjoy the same delicious texture without gluten.
What can I add to make these brownies more decadent?
For an extra indulgent treat, consider adding chocolate chips, caramel swirls, or crushed cookies to the batter before baking. You could also top the brownies with a rich frosting or a dusting of powdered sugar for a beautiful finish.
